What are the advantages of holding a Medical Marijuana card in Rockville?
Lowers costs and Taxes
Carrying a medical marijuana card in Rockville allows you to pay fewer taxes and receive exclusive discounts. This allows you to save money over the course of the year when compared to recreational users who pay an excise tax on their purchases.
Availability of Different Products
Medical marijuana patients have access to a broader range of cannabis products, including high-potency products developed to treat specific medical illnesses, as opposed to recreational users who are restricted by lower potency rules.
Higher Possession and Purchase Limits
Cardholders are allowed to possess and purchase up to 4 ounces (120 grams) of cannabis, but recreational users are limited to 1.5 ounces (42 grams).
Legal Protection
A medical cannabis card offers significant legal protection, allowing for higher possession limits and fewer restrictions than recreational use.
Access for Younger Patients
Patients under the age of 21 who have qualifying medical conditions can also benefit from a medical cannabis card, which allows them legal access to cannabis.

Qualifying Conditions for a Medical Marijuana Card in Rockville, Maryland
To be eligible for a medical marijuana card in Rockville, Maryland, patients must be diagnosed with one of the following qualifying medical conditions:
- Anorexia
- Chronic Pain
- Severe Nausea
- Severe Pain
- Muscle spasms
- Cachexia
- Glaucoma
- PTSD
- Seizures
- Wasting Syndrome
As acceptable eligibility for a Maryland Medical Marijuana Card, the state also allows any other chronic or debilitating medical condition for which the other treatments have been ineffective.
Caregivers in Rockville
After completing specific conditions, Rockville carers can apply online to assist patients in accessing medical marijuana. They must be above 21 years old and register with the Maryland Medical Cannabis Commission (MMCC), which costs $50.
Once carers have received their MMCC Carer ID Card, they can easily purchase medical marijuana from a certified Rockville dispensary and distribute it to their patients. Carers can only assist five patients at a time, although patients can have up to two carers. Minor patients under the age of 18 require at least one carer, who must be a parent or legal guardian. Carers must register with the MMCC before their minor patient can be enrolled.

How Long Does Rockville Medical Marijuana Card Last?
A Rockville medical marijuana card is valid for up to one year, but patients must recertify annually.
What documents do you need to apply for a Rockville MMJ Card?
To apply for your MMJ card permit, you will need the following documents:
- A valid government-issued photo ID (e.g., driver’s license, passport).
- Proof of Maryland residency (e.g., utility bill, lease agreement).
- A recent passport-sized photo.
- Medical records or documentation from your physician stating your qualifying condition.
